How to get from Dolzago to Varedo by bus and train?

From Dolzago to Varedo by bus and train

To get from Dolzago to Varedo in Milan and Lombardy,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the D160 bus from Dolzago - Corsica Street station to Oggiono - Railway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the S7 train and finally take the Z205 bus from Monza Railway Station - Castello Gate station to Varedo - Umberto I Street 145 station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 48 min. The bus and train schedule from Dolzago may change.
